Individual dwellings made on small plots are always difficult. The restrictions given by legislation ( plot ocupation, withdrawals from property limit) greatly reduced the proposal design.

The totally atypical design theme constrained even more. The clients wanted a temporary home with a big open space and the analysis of a future extension for a bedroom with bathroom.

The proposed dwelling is a monobloc volume played volumetrically from terraces and access staircase.

Space reserved for the expansion is located upstairs, thus, in the event of expansion, the dwelling can be divided in 2 different habitable apartments.
